Crew Lead
Emcor Group, Inc.
Leading provider of electrical, mechanical, and energy solutions across diverse industries.
Leading a crew responsible for hard services execution and maintenance in a manufacturing environment, ensuring minimal downtime and proactive problem resolution.
Upon receipt of a corrective work request, respond within 15 minutes to determine priority (P1, 2 or 3) and resources needed to resolve the issue.
Establish relationships with ASML production leadership on their assigned shift to ensure good communication when issues arise.
Ensure employees are trained in the safe operation of equipment.
May need to support non-customary schedules and weekend work
Monitor list of PM’s that can be bundled with reactive WO’s.
Ensure training program includes cross-training.
Work with Planner/Scheduler to ensure technician availability for PM’s and reactive work.
Update site manager on reactive work status (2-hour cycle)
Provide daily objectives and priorities for all teammates and vendors working on your assigned shift.
Manage Issues arising on their shift to completion utilizing and directing EMCOR Technicians and/or subcontractors. If Issue cannot be resolved, establish a short term corrective action to maximize equipment uptime.
Update site manager by EOB daily on the effectiveness of bundling.
Document discussions with Craft personnel
Performs building / WO audits in the field Documenting and reporting the status of critical equipment and processes during the shift.
Execute the escalation process as outlined by the process.
Facilitate Shift Turnover Mtg insuring all paperwork is completed for their assigned shift.
Abides by all safety guidelines including OSHA regulations, lock-out/tag-out, etc. Driving the EMCOR Operating and Safety Culture within their assigned crew.
Ensure the assigned technician has list of PM’s that can be bundled to reactive WO.
Maintain employees’ training records and the operations that they are authorized to perform.
Responsible for determining plan to resolve any issues arising on their assigned shift. If root cause is not able to be repaired, establish a short-term plan to maximize production uptime and a long-term plan to resolve the root cause. Take Ownership of the issue and manage crew and/or vendor to execute the established plan.
Ensure the assigned employees are in their assigned work area.
Ensure all employees are wearing proper PPE.
Facilitate meetings with assigned crew to include shift turnover, Daily Safety Toolbox, Weekly safety, and any production meetings assigned during shift.
